Just scored 6 sweet Hendrix Discs

Anyone ever heard of "The Authentic PPX Studio Recordings Vols 1-6"? Its Hendrix playing in a band prior to having his own gig. He's playing with a dude named Curtis Knight. Has a very heavy blues feel to it, and they play a bunch of songs you all know from the era (lots of James Brown, etc). He's on guitar, and does a very limited amount of backup vocals.

The only two worth having are Barret and Madcap Laughs. They are the only two with original material; Opel re-hashes material on those two. Both are fantastic, but if I had to choose, Barret is my favorite. There are some later BBC recordings that are kind of interesting, but musically they are garbage. Barret had completely lost it by then. Oh, and by the way, he didn't get along with anybody, so his rift with Hendrix comes as no surprise. If you want more Barret, there is always the first Floyd album as well, Piper at the Gates of Dawn. Every song but one is a Barret composition; good stuff.
